Photography in the Modernist Movement 1900-1940


Teachers Unit Guide


Student Activity Guides
Internet Search and Research Ansel Adams, Dorthea Lange, and Margaret Bourke-White
Digital Camera and Photo-Loader Review how to use your digital camera. Take pictures of Photographers works to add to a Power Point presentation
Field Experience You will be traveling to Yosemite, Local Farms and Down Town to take photos.
Photo-Loader You will upload and manipulate the photos you took at Yosemite, on Local Farms and Down Town
Power Point You will create a Power Point presentation with images and information you obtained
Presentation and Reflection You will present and reflect on your findings
